Within the local Airlie Beach area are a range of self drive tours and walks that can be taken through
national park forests, up to the tops of the local peaks,
through rainforest gullies and out to untouched stretches
of the Coral Sea coastline.
Drive
Walks start within 10 minutes
drive of Airlie Beach and some begin at Airlie Beach.
Highlights
Airlie Beach – A day walk from Airlie Beach rises
steeply through tulip oak forests to the ridge tops for expansive
views of the islands and Whitsunday Passage.
Great Walk Whitsunday – Walks
range from one hour to 30kms/three days. Walkers traverse
over seasonal creeks,
enter lush palm groves and scale kills to views over
the Whitsundays.
Conway Range National Park – On the
way to Shute Harbour are a series of walks in national
parklands from
wetlands to peaks and down pristine coastline. Circuits
range from 1km to 5.4kms.
Shute Harbour – views of the picturesque Shute harbour
and Australia’s second busiest commuter quay from
Lion’s Lookout.
Coral Point – Atop Shute Harbour,
enjoy panoramic views of the Whitsunday Passage.
